In a redox reaction, the number of electrons lost
is equal to the number of
(1) protons lost (3) neutrons gained
(2) neutrons lost (4) electrons gained

Respuesta :

Billymkhoi
Billymkhoi Billymkhoi
  • 04-01-2016
(4) electrons gained is the correct answer.
